The purpose of this research is to develop a guided discovery-based mathematics e-module with a STEAM approach to facilitate students' mathematical problem solving skills that meet the valid, practical, and effective criteria using the ADDIE development model. The subjects in this study were validators including lecturers and teachers as well as students of SMP Negeri 1 Tandun. The object of the research is a guided discovery-based math e-module with a STEAM approach. Data collection used questionnaire and test techniques. The research instruments consisted of validity test instruments in the form of instrument validation sheets, e-module validation sheets by learning material and educational technology experts, practicality test instruments in the form of student response questionnaire sheets, and effectiveness test instruments in the form of posttest questions. The data analysis techniques used are quantitative and qualitative data analysis techniques. Based on the results of the data analysis, it was concluded that the guided discovery-based mathematics e-module with the STEAM approach was declared to have met the criteria of being very valid, very practical, and also effective. This shows that the math e-module based on guided discovery with the STEAM approach to facilitate students' mathematical problem solving skills that has been developed is suitable to be used as teaching material in the learning process.
